The seventh edition of the International Hydro-Power conference will begin in Jammu & Kashmir from June 11,with a focus on challenges and opportunities in harnessing hydro power in Northern Himalayas. Leading hydro-power developers and technocrats from around the world and policy and decision makers are expected to participate in the two-day conference which will begin on June 11,an official spokesman said. He said the conference titled 'Harnessing Hydro Power in Northern Himalaya-Challenges and Opportunities' with special focus on Jammu and Kashmir is being organised by India TECH Foundation. It will be inaugurated by state Chief Minister Omar Abdullah. Chief Ministers and power Ministers from various states and senior officers from Union power and water resources ministries are also expected to participate,the spokesman said.
